超链接是js该怎么办
在当今的网页开发中,JavaScript(JS)作为一门强大的前端技术,为用户带来了丰富的交互体验。当遇到超链接问题时,很多开发者可能会感到困惑。今天,我们就来探讨一下“超链接是js该怎么办”这个问题,并提供一些实用的解决方案。
一、超链接的基本概念
1.超链接的定义
超链接是网页中用于链接到其他页面、文件或资源的文本或图像。通过点击超链接,用户可以跳转到另一个页面或执行特定操作。
2.超链接的组成
超链接由以下部分组成:
-链接文本或图像:用户点击的部分。
-链接地址(URL):超链接的目标地址。
二、使用JavaScript处理超链接
1.改变链接的默认行为
当超链接使用JavaScript处理时,我们可以阻止其默认的跳转行为,并实现自定义的交互效果。
2.使用JavaScript事件处理函数
在HTML中,我们可以通过给超链接元素添加事件监听器,来处理点击事件。
3.使用事件委托
在多个超链接需要统一处理的情况下,我们可以利用事件委托来简化代码。
三、解决超链接问题的具体方法
1.阻止默认行为
当超链接使用JavaScript处理时,我们通常需要阻止其默认的跳转行为。这可以通过在事件处理函数中调用event.preventDefault()方法实现。
2.自定义跳转逻辑
在事件处理函数中,我们可以根据需要编写自定义的逻辑,例如打开新的页面、显示弹窗等。
3.使用`标签的href`属性
在JavaScript处理超链接时,我们仍然可以使用`标签的href`属性来指定跳转地址。
四、实际案例
1.点击超链接时,显示一个确认对话框
document.getElementById("myLink").addEventListener("click",function(event){event.preventDefault()
if(confirm("您确定要继续吗?")){
window.location.href=this.href
2.点击超链接时,打开新窗口
document.getElementById("myLink").addEventListener("click",function(event){event.preventDefault()
window.open(this.href,"_blank")
五、
**针对“超链接是js该怎么办”的问题,从超链接的基本概念、JavaScript处理超链接的方法以及实际案例等方面进行了详细解答。希望**能为遇到相同问题的开发者提供帮助。在网页开发中,灵活运用JavaScript处理超链接,可以使页面更加丰富和具有交互性。
本文地址:
http://www.zbcp1888.com/xmsz/art27c6db5.html
发布于 2025-12-16 09:19:57
文章转载或复制请以
超链接形式
并注明出处
中部网
